General
=======
	Various "copy edit" types of repairs.
	Revisions to document cross-linking.
	Added structural links tying all docs together (banners
	   at top and bottom of documents, similar to Reference Manual
	   banners of the Beta release).
	Set background color to white in all documents.

NCSAfooterlogo.gif
hdf2.jpg
	New image files to make the documents more self-contained
	(i.e., to prevent loading images from NCSA and HDF home servers).

index.html
	Redesigned to isolate links external to the installation
	in a single location.


Intro to HDF5
=============
H5.intro.html
	Fixed banner linking Intro to other docs.
	Set all URLs to be relative within the distribution; nothing
	   points back to the HDF server.
	Updates to "Limits of the Current Release" and "Changes in
	   the Current Release."


HDF5 User's Guide
=================
	Changed several User Guide section titles such that all
	   sections that are primarily about a particular interface
	   are now titled in the format "The xxxxx Interface (H5x)".

H5.user.html
	Commented out links to developer docs since they are marked
	   in MANIFEST as not being for distribution in the release.
	Removed 2nd and 3rd indices from page.
	Changed "freeform" lists of sections (TOCs) to aligned tables.

Datatypes.html
	Removed the sentence "I'm deferring definition until later
	   since they're probably not as important as the other data
	   types." from Section 3.3, "Properties of Date and Time
	   Atomic Types."
	Added info regarding 'char' versus 'string' datatypes.  Added
	   as Section 3.7, "Character and String Datatype Issues."

References.html
	Commented out substantial material (at end of document) from
	   References planning document that is not appropriate for
 	   the User Guide but that is worth keeping around.

Groups.html
	Final edits from elimination of "current working group."


HDF5 Reference Manual
=====================
	Removed "Draft" from the <title>__</title> lines.

RM_H5Front.html
	Removed 2nd and 3rd indices from page.
	Changed "freeform" lists of sections (TOCs) to aligned tables.

RM_H5F.html
RM_H5P.html
	Add file mounting information.

<h1>HDF5: API Specification<br>Reference Manual</h1>
</center>
The HDF5 library provides several interfaces, each of which provides the
tools required to meet specific aspects of the HDF5 data-handling requirements.
<center>
<table border=0>
<tr><td valign=top><a href="RM_H5.html">Library Functions</a>
</td><td>&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p;</td><td valign=top>The general-purpose <strong>H5</strong> functions.
</td></tr>
<tr><td valign=top><a href="RM_H5A.html">Annotation Interface</a>
</td><td></td><td valign=top>The <strong>H5A</strong> API for annotations.
</td></tr>
<tr><td valign=top><a href="RM_H5D.html">Dataset Interface</a>
</td><td></td><td valign=top>The <strong>H5D</strong> API for manipulating scientific datasets.
</td></tr>
<tr><td valign=top><a href="RM_H5E.html">Error Interface</a>
</td><td></td><td valign=top>The <strong>H5E</strong> API for error handling.
</td></tr>
<tr><td valign=top><a href="RM_H5F.html">File Interface</a>
</td><td></td><td valign=top>The <strong>H5F</strong> API for accessing HDF files.
</td></tr>
<tr><td valign=top><a href="RM_H5G.html">Group Interface</a>
</td><td></td><td valign=top>The <strong>H5G</strong> API for creating physical groups of objects on disk.
</td></tr>
<tr><td valign=top><a href="RM_H5I.html">Identifier Interface</a>
</td><td></td><td valign=top>The <strong>H5I</strong> API for working with object identifiers.
</td></tr>
<tr><td valign=top><a href="RM_H5P.html">Property List Interface</a>
</td><td></td><td valign=top>The <strong>H5P</strong> API for manipulating object property lists.
</td></tr>
<tr><td valign=top><a href="RM_H5R.html">Reference Interface</a>
</td><td></td><td valign=top>The <strong>H5R</strong> API for references.
</td></tr>
<tr><td valign=top><a href="RM_H5S.html">Dataspace Interface</a>
</td><td></td><td valign=top>The <strong>H5S</strong> API for defining dataset dataspace.
</td></tr>
<tr><td valign=top><a href="RM_H5T.html">Datatype Interface</a>
</td><td></td><td valign=top>The <strong>H5T</strong> API for defining dataset element information.
</td></tr>
<tr><td valign=top><a href="RM_H5Z.html">Compression Interface</a>
</td><td></td><td valign=top>The <strong>H5Z</strong> API for compression.
</td></tr>
<tr><td valign=top><a href="Tools.html">Tools</a>
</td><td></td><td valign=top>Interactive tools for the examination of existing HDF5 files.
<!--
</td></tr>
<tr><td valign=top><a href="Glossary.html">Glossary</a>
</td><td></td><td valign=top>A glossary of data-types used in the APIs.
-->
</td></tr>
<tr><td valign=top><hr noshade size=1>Experimental interface:<br><a href="RM_H5RA.html">Ragged Arrays</a>&nbsp;&nbsp;
</td><td></td><td valign=top><hr noshade size=1><br>The <strong>H5RA</strong> API for ragged arrays.
</td></tr>
</table>
